dc.description.abstractBackground: In water purification are used synthetic coagulants that are related problems such as Alzheimer’s and high toxic sludge production (1), being necessary assess natural coagulants as an alternative to the removal of turbidity (2) that are less harmful to health and the environment (3). Objective: Evaluate the efficiency of coagulation moringa oleifera seeds lam. Methods: This research was conducted in two phases: The first evaluated four extracts of Moringa oleifera Lam, in order to find the best extraction method using a fixed effect unifactorial design completely randomized balanced by jartest under the NTC 3903, working confunsing factor dose of coagulant, in the second stage it was evaluated using a factorial design 22 efficiency seed coagulant Moringa oleifera lam. Results: determining that the best method is the extraction to use saline (p<0.05), as the response variable was found turbidity removal and the optimum factors for a 97% removal are: dose 274.9 mg/l coagulant extract and pH 7.1 with a 95% confidence (p <0.05), Conclusions: Further to this evaluation the clotting mechanism of seed extract Moringa oleifera Lam was determined by sedimentation rate, which allowed to represent the dynamic behavior of turbidity removal by a mathematical model based on differential equations of the first order, finding the maximum removal time is 20 minutes and the sedimentation rate of 0.003 cm/ s clotting mechanism is charge neutralization and adsorption. © 2016, Universidad de Antioquia.
